Greetings to the latest installment at the WTA Finals. Although both matches promise excitement, the primary attraction showcases Swiatek facing off with Anisimova.
Their last meeting at the Wimbledon Championships four months ago proved extremely lopsided, with the Polish star achieving a decisive 6-0, 6-0 win. However, the American player made an impressive recovery just weeks later, overcoming Swiatek in convincing fashion during the US Open quarter-finals.
Today's match represents the third chapter of their ongoing battle, with the winner progressing to the semi-finals in the Saudi Arabian capital.
Earlier in the day, Rybakina will face Ekaterina Alexandrova replacing the originally scheduled opponent. The American player withdrew due to health issues in what constitutes a dead rubber, paving the way for the tenth-ranked player to participate. The Kazakh star aims to continue her unbeaten streak, having already beaten both Swiatek and Anisimova to secure her semi-final position.
